RESOLUTION NO. 92-672
REDUCING DEVELOPMENT BOND
CHURCHILL FARMS 4TH ADDITION (92022)
WHEREAS, in accordance with the development contract dated April 29, 1992, Lundgren
Brothers Construction, Inc., developer of Churchill Farms 4th Addition (92022) has
agreed to install certain improvements for said development; and
WHEREAS, the developer has completed a portion of the street, utility and site grading
as noted below; and
WHEREAS, the developer has requested a reduction of the development bond to reflect the
completed work;
N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T HEREBY RESOLVED BY THE CITY CO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F PLYMOUTH that
the bonding requirements are reduced as follows:

That the letter of credit required for the above items (excluding Project No. 016) is
hereby reduced as detailed above from $286,776 to $77,291.
* The required financial guarantee for this was provided with Churchill Farms Addition
(90009).
FURTHER BE IT RESOLVED that the bonding requirements for the following items per
Section 8.1 of the approved development contract be reduced as follows:
I= ORIGINAL AMOUNT NEW AMOUNT
Maintenance of Erosion and
Sediment Control Plan,
Street Sweeping and Storm
Sewer Cleaning Cash: $ 11000 $ 1,000
Letter of Credit: $17,250 $ 3,450
FURTHER BE IT RESOLVED that the required financial guarantees for the above items
remain at $1,000 cash with the required Letter of Credit No. 8513-0 being reduced from
$17,250 to $3,450.
Adopted by the City Council on October 26, 1992
